JOSHUA TREE, Calif. – November 28, 2018 – During the month of November, the Hi-Desert Medical Center (HDMC) Patient PEP Squad hosted a hospital-wide Thanksgiving Food Drive, benefitting Black Rock High School as well as Unity Home, an organization that supports victims of domestic violence. Additionally, employees of HDMC and the Continuing Care Center nominated fellow employees to also be some recipients of these delicious baskets.

“I continue to be amazed by the generous spirit of our employees,” said Karen Faulis, CEO of Hi-Desert Medical Center. “It’s great to work with a team that gives their all to looking after our patients in the hospital and members of our community outside of the hospital.”

Employees of HDMC generously donated more than 200 items, consisting of non-perishable food and frozen turkeys, to create 10 boxes that were distributed to members of the community on November 20.
